Established in 1953, Sportsman's has been a beloved community corner bar in Mt. Sterling for more than six decades, offering patrons a welcoming atmosphere and great prices. Under the ownership of Nicole and Tim Wachter since 2015, the bar is deeply engaged in local charitable efforts and community events, including music fundraisers and outdoor activities.
In addition to its status as a neighborhood favorite, Sportsman's launched the Hop Garden in 2019, providing a seasonal outdoor venue outfitted with a covered stage, a bar for frozen drinks, and spacious seating. This expansion reflects the establishment's commitment to enhancing the local experience while serving as a vibrant hub for social gatherings and entertainment.
